What companies run services between Geneva, Switzerland and Pontremoli, Italy?

You can take a train from Genève to Pontremoli via Domodossola and Milano Centrale in around 9h 21m. Alternatively, Gruppo Di Maio operates a bus from Geneve, Gare Routiere to La Spezia twice a week. Tickets cost €40–60 and the journey takes 8h 10m.
